N2 - Objectives: This is a protocol for a Cochrane Review (intervention). The objectives are as follows:. To assess the benefits and harms of non-surgical treatment versus placebo or no treatment for lower limb apophyseal injuries in children and adolescents on pain, function, participation in physical activity, and participant-reported treatment success.
